Armstrong Utilities is Hiring a Director of Technology Near Butler, PA

The Director of Technology will be responsible for leading the technology team which is responsible for understanding the technology landscape and evaluating new technology for our Network as well as services for residential, commercial, and enterprise customers. This role will be involved in industry groups such as Cable Labs/SCTE and other MSO communities. Deep understanding of Armstrong’s strategic mission and will stay ahead of new and emerging technologies in all the technology areas focusing on 3–5-year vision and outlook. Qualifications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ering or Engineering Technology. Advanced Engineering degree preferred. 15 years Telecommunications experience with a minimum of 10 years’ Engineering or operations experience. Ability to work on Armstrong diverse technology areas. Must be a servant leader and work well in a team environment - have the ability to positively engage team and other departments. Demonstrate flexibility in thinking and process in an effort to drive a continuous improvement environment. Strong understanding of Plant, Network, CPE and Service delivery and technologies. Strong communication skills -must have the ability to effectively communicate at all levels within multiple business units. Ability to present and propose new technologies and vision to the Senior leadership team. Build and maintain strong vendor relationships. Flexibility and ability to understand key stake holders needs and accept feedback. Responsibilities Lead team of Technology Directors/Principal Engineers, setting priorities that match the business needs Evaluate and stay ahead of trends in the industry Active participant in the industry active on committees and presenting at industry event Responsible for owning the technology portfolio and growing it. Technical leadership within the company. Work with Engineering leadership on moving solutions from evaluation, testing and deployment. Provide engineering guidance and support for facilities including new and augment of existing. Create RFP/RFIs and review proposals. Manage vendor relationships as necessary to achieve corporate and departmental goals. Evaluate and recommend vendor solutions for new and existing products. Work with marketing product management on developing new customer products for both residential and commercial customers. Evaluate ways to deploy network and service in a faster and more efficient way. Visit Armstrong’s systems and interact with local leadership and Field operations to understand challenges. Interact collaboratively to support other departments as necessary. Perform other related tasks as assigned. Armstrong is an Equal Opportunity Employer. Who We Are The Armstrong Group is a family owned and operated collection of diverse companies. What began in 1946 as Armstrong County Line Construction, founded by Jud L. Sedwick in Kittanning, PA, has now grown into an organization that encompasses multiple industries and employs over 2,400 individuals nationwide. Our brands include Armstrong Utilities, Guardian Protection, Armstrong Development, 4Front Solutions, Twin Pops, and Armstrong Comfort Solutions. Armstrong is an Equal Opportunity Employer. The Armstrong Group, a family owned and operated business, now employs over 2,000 people across the nation. The company continues to value strong relationships with its employees and close ties to the communities it serves.
